Insecure Attachment
Attachment behavior characterized by avoiding caregiver, excessive clinging, or inconsistency.
Ambivalent/Resistant Attachment
A type of insecure attachment characterized by anxiety and uncertainty in relationships, often resulting from inconsistent caregiving.
Attachment Styles
Patterns of attachment behavior shown by individuals in close relationships, shaped by early interactions with caregivers.
